Consortium is correct a RU certificate is like a gift card good for having a RU sent to you. So once you win it, if we have any (totally not necessary), then you contact RSI and they send you a free RU. Thus you pay $5 per cert to buy it then the winner gets a RU sheet for free.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

To Tripwire's question: You can move fast to slow so if you have a prized dead warrior in an inactive, or active, fast arena you can move the team to arena 28 and hope to win the limited rez potion and get him back.

I know at least one manager is prizing the possible +1 potions above all else. You could move a bonused warrior from a fast arena team to 28 and possibly make him more bonused... and maybe learn his faves!

The possibility of moving a fast arena team to a slow arena is a strong part of why a slow arena was chosen. It is also more all inclusive to some people whose mail is slow.
